Suspension Affect Acceleration. What is vehicle dynamics and why is it studied? It is demonstrated that sprung mass acceleration increases by 50%, when the vehicle mass varies by 100 kg. To put it simply, vehicle dynamics is the application of classical mechanics in physics to cars to predict and control. In some suspension systems the lateral load transfer can create a large change in ride heights at the front and rear as the car squats under acceleration or dives during braking. A bump on the road initiating a suspension jounce event has more impact on ride comfort than a rebound event. In order to obtain consistent damping performance from the shock absorber, it is essential to vary its stiffness and damping properties. The suspension on your car maximizes friction between the tires and road and provides steering stability.
